Transaction 69669125feab18fa60e9d87cc2ced2582b57cc2496517728186e1a2f29edcfd7
1 Input
1 Output
-
69669125feab18fa60e9d87cc2ced2582b57cc2496517728186e1a2f29edcfd7:0
- value
- 1525826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4de38c2a21c577cf53f8c234ed431e3d267d9d24 OP_EQUAL
- address
- 38nrYbNVLWn2jsDr4LM9Q5qBhe41RYjG8H